Honda is touting increased relationships with semiconductor manufacturers, including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Limited. Overall, the company is aiming for 10 new EVs in the Chinese market by 2027, with 100 percent electrification by 2035. In this case, Honda wants to be 100 percent EV and fuel-cell EV by 2040.
